
Introduction
Actuarial Modeling Software are specialized platforms used by actuaries and financial professionals to model risk, forecast financial outcomes, and support decision-making in insurance, pensions, and investment sectors. These tools help organizations evaluate uncertainty, calculate reserves, price products, and ensure long-term financial stability.
In simple terms, actuarial modeling software turns complex data and assumptions into financial projections that guide critical business decisions. As regulatory demands increase and risk environments become more dynamic, these platforms are essential for accuracy, transparency, and efficiency.
Common use cases include:
- Insurance product pricing and valuation
- Risk modeling and scenario analysis
- Reserving and capital modeling
- Regulatory reporting and compliance
- Financial forecasting and projections
